  1. As of 2024
    Singapore imports more than 90% of its food supply.

  2. As of 2025
    By 2035, Singapore aims for local farms to supply 20% of local fibre consumption.

  3. As of 2025
    By 2035, Singapore aims for local farms to supply 30% of local protein consumption, referring to eggs and seafood.

  4. As of 2025
    Potted plants in a common corridor require Town Council or management permission and at least 1.2 metres of unobstructed escape width.

  5. As of 2026
    NEA advises households to avoid or regularly empty plant-pot plates, keep common-corridor scupper drains clear, and check water-holding receptacles so water does not pond.
